Certainly, Sri Lankan cloves are known for their distinctive qualities and are highly regarded in the culinary and medicinal world. Here's a bit more information about these cloves:

Origin and Production: Sri Lanka, a tropical country with a conducive climate, is a significant producer of high-quality cloves. The cloves are sourced from the Syzygium aromaticum tree, which is native to the region. The plant's unique combination of soil, climate, and cultivation practices contributes to the exceptional flavor and aroma of Sri Lankan cloves.

 

Appearance and Color: Sri Lankan cloves typically have a dark brown to reddish-brown color. This rich coloration indicates that they are mature and have developed the essential oils responsible for their intense flavor and fragrance.

 Aroma and Flavor: The aroma of Sri Lankan cloves is characterized by a strong, spicy scent that is both aromatic and captivating. This aroma is a result of the high essential oil content found within the cloves. When it comes to flavor, Sri Lankan cloves offer an intense, sweet, and slightly peppery taste, making them an essential ingredient in various cuisines.

 

 Culinary and Medicinal Uses: Sri Lankan cloves are widely used in cooking and baking to add depth and complexity to dishes. They are often employed in spice blends, marinades, curries, and desserts. Due to their potent flavor, a little goes a long way. Beyond their culinary applications, cloves have been traditionally used for their potential medicinal benefits, which include aiding digestion, providing relief from toothaches, and possessing anti-inflammatory properties.

 

Harvesting and Processing: To ensure optimal quality, Sri Lankan cloves are harvested at the right stage of maturity, usually when the flower buds are still closed. This is when they contain the highest concentration of essential oils. The cloves are carefully handpicked to prevent damage. Following harvesting, the cloves are sun-dried or gently heat-dried to preserve their essential oil content. This delicate drying process prevents overexposure to heat, which could diminish their flavor and aroma.

 

 Export and Value: Sri Lankan cloves are a sought-after commodity in both local and international markets. The country's reputation for producing cloves of exceptional quality has established its place as a key player in the global spice trade. The export of high-quality Sri Lankan cloves contributes significantly to the country's economy.
